Transaction dbae3186633ce7827ef62dd9978e692966df6567346a58923c5a4ab38c6dcbd9
1 Input
1 Output
-
dbae3186633ce7827ef62dd9978e692966df6567346a58923c5a4ab38c6dcbd9:0
- value
- 501792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ef90bd88ec5def207fa21af7efd06a4788346c7e OP_EQUAL
- address
- 3PXip8QSifxyXupVnSdrt1nZKV6afYb8nL